resolvedCoverageSurfaces() trusts any terminal current surface's authored id. Since the live draft schema allows coverage.surfaces[].id, a later draft can reuse a historical deferred surface ID on an unrelated surface and clear that deferral. Match the ID to the historical surface identity, or strip/reject authored IDs, and add a spoofed-ID regression.
Summary
Fixes #741.
Interim scan checkpoints intentionally preserve deferred coverage so later writers cannot erase unfinished work by omission. That preservation also restored a linked deferral after the final draft had explicitly given every referenced surface a terminal disposition. The restored row downgraded otherwise complete coverage to partial and made the canonical result contradict the final draft.

The reconciliation rule is limited to deferred rows with a nonempty
surfaceIdslist whose every reference resolves to one terminal surface. Missing references, follow-up outcomes, and duplicate semantic surfaces remain deferred, so the existing loss-prevention behavior stays in place. No public CLI, schema, stored-artifact format, dependency, or migration changes are required.Public disclosure review
